2010-09-29 5 views
2

Je développe l'application asp.net pour les appareils mobiles. J'utilise Response.Redirect dans la plupart des pages. Le problème que j'ai ici est que certains des anciens modèles de nokia ont toujours un message d'avertissement pop-up demandant de confirmer l'envoi de données vers un site différent si j'essaie de rediriger vers une autre page. Et quand il frappe la page redirigée, la propriété IsPostback est vraie même si c'est la première charge pour une raison quelconque. C'est assez ennuyeux que je ne puisse pas implémenter de logique pour le chargement de la première page. Si j'utilise Server.Transfer, le message d'avertissement ne sortira pas et tout fonctionne correctement, cependant, j'ai une autre raison de ne pas utiliser Server.Transfer. Est-ce que quelqu'un a une solution?Response.Redirect problème dans certains téléphones Nokia

Répondre

0

Nous avons construit un site WAP il y a quelques années (4 ou 5. Je pense) et avons découvert que la seule façon de le faire fonctionner (sans avertissement) sur ces vieux téléphones Nokia est d'éviter Response.Redirect.

Évitez d'utiliser complètement les formulaires ASP.NET et écrivez le HTML comme dans les jours ASP (n'utilisez pas ViewState, publiez sur une autre page, utilisez autant que possible les paramètres de requête.)

Questions connexes